Setting reflect_x in Wayland
I'm able to set reflect_x
on one of my monitors using the Nvidia X Server Settings when using X11 (X Server Display Configuration > Orientation > Reflect along X). This sets the "metamodes"
option on the Screen to "{reflection=X}"
.
Since upgrading to Fedora 34 I am now trying to use Wayland by default (as Nvidia is now supporting it) but I can't seem to find a similar setting for it under Wayland - there was never an option to do this in the Gnome settings (that I could see) and of course the Nvidia settings panel only targets X11.
The use-case here is a teleprompter - the monitor is being reflected so needs to be flipped in software to compensate. It's a relatively niche use-case but not all that uncommon, so hopefully it's something worth supporting :)
